How to prepare for a job interview at Focus Resourcing Group

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your residential conveyancing knowledge. Familiarise yourself with the latest regulations and practices in the field, as well as any recent changes that might affect your work. This will show your potential employer that you're not just experienced but also proactive about staying current.

Showcase Your Experience

Prepare to discuss specific cases or transactions you've handled in the past. Highlight your problem-solving skills and how you've navigated challenges in conveyancing. This is your chance to demonstrate your 5+ years of PQE and how it makes you a perfect fit for their team.

Ask Insightful Questions

Come prepared with questions that show your interest in the firm and the role. Ask about their approach to client relationships or how they handle complex transactions.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the firm aligns with your career goals.

Dress the Part

While it’s important to be yourself, remember that first impressions count. Dress professionally to reflect the seriousness of the role. A smart appearance can boost your confidence and set a positive tone for the interview.
